[gimp] app: remove gimp_layer_mask_new_from_buffer() and some includes



commit 6c506509b6cb93737ac7aace09d85105415b33e8
Author: Michael Natterer <mitch gimp org>
Date:   Tue Jun 19 13:20:15 2018 +0200

    app: remove gimp_layer_mask_new_from_buffer() and some includes

 app/core/gimplayermask.c | 30 ------------------------------
 app/core/gimplayermask.h | 28 +++++++++++-----------------
 2 files changed, 11 insertions(+), 47 deletions(-)
---
diff --git a/app/core/gimplayermask.c b/app/core/gimplayermask.c
index 11f105dbce..42d6787416 100644
--- a/app/core/gimplayermask.c
+++ b/app/core/gimplayermask.c
@@ -17,22 +17,15 @@
 
 #include "config.h"
 
-#include <stdlib.h>
-#include <string.h>
-
 #include <gdk-pixbuf/gdk-pixbuf.h>
 #include <gegl.h>
 
-#include "libgimpmath/gimpmath.h"
-
 #include "core-types.h"
 
 #include "gegl/gimp-babl.h"
-#include "gegl/gimp-gegl-loops.h"
 
 #include "gimperror.h"
 #include "gimpimage.h"
-#include "gimpimage-undo-push.h"
 #include "gimplayer.h"
 #include "gimplayermask.h"
 
@@ -214,29 +207,6 @@ gimp_layer_mask_new (GimpImage     *image,
   return layer_mask;
 }
 
-GimpLayerMask *
-gimp_layer_mask_new_from_buffer (GeglBuffer    *buffer,
-                                 GimpImage     *image,
-                                 const gchar   *name,
-                                 const GimpRGB *color)
-{
-  GimpLayerMask *layer_mask;
-  GeglBuffer    *dest;
-
-  g_return_val_if_fail (GEGL_IS_BUFFER (buffer), NULL);
-  g_return_val_if_fail (GIMP_IS_IMAGE (image), NULL);
-
-  layer_mask = gimp_layer_mask_new (image,
-                                    gegl_buffer_get_width  (buffer),
-                                    gegl_buffer_get_height (buffer),
-                                    name, color);
-
-  dest = gimp_drawable_get_buffer (GIMP_DRAWABLE (layer_mask));
-  gimp_gegl_buffer_copy (buffer, NULL, GEGL_ABYSS_NONE, dest, NULL);
-
-  return layer_mask;
-}
-
 void
 gimp_layer_mask_set_layer (GimpLayerMask *layer_mask,
                            GimpLayer     *layer)
diff --git a/app/core/gimplayermask.h b/app/core/gimplayermask.h
index c5f6c60263..d5cfd2fdf5 100644
--- a/app/core/gimplayermask.h
+++ b/app/core/gimplayermask.h
@@ -45,23 +45,17 @@ struct _GimpLayerMaskClass
 };
 
 
-/*  function declarations  */
-
-GType           gimp_layer_mask_get_type        (void) G_GNUC_CONST;
-
-GimpLayerMask * gimp_layer_mask_new             (GimpImage     *image,
-                                                 gint           width,
-                                                 gint           height,
-                                                 const gchar   *name,
-                                                 const GimpRGB *color);
-GimpLayerMask * gimp_layer_mask_new_from_buffer (GeglBuffer    *buffer,
-                                                 GimpImage     *image,
-                                                 const gchar   *name,
-                                                 const GimpRGB *color);
-
-void            gimp_layer_mask_set_layer       (GimpLayerMask *layer_mask,
-                                                 GimpLayer     *layer);
-GimpLayer     * gimp_layer_mask_get_layer       (GimpLayerMask *layer_mask);
+GType           gimp_layer_mask_get_type  (void) G_GNUC_CONST;
+
+GimpLayerMask * gimp_layer_mask_new       (GimpImage     *image,
+                                           gint           width,
+                                           gint           height,
+                                           const gchar   *name,
+                                           const GimpRGB *color);
+
+void            gimp_layer_mask_set_layer (GimpLayerMask *layer_mask,
+                                           GimpLayer     *layer);
+GimpLayer     * gimp_layer_mask_get_layer (GimpLayerMask *layer_mask);
 
 
 #endif /* __GIMP_LAYER_MASK_H__ */


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]